Lions spank Royals

HUNDREDS of cricket fans witnessed a case of blatant “child abuse” in Queen’s Park on Sunday night, but not even the “victims” complained.

Indeed, an enjoyable time was had by all who attended the Twenty20 tapeball cricket match between the Starcom/NATION Conquering Lions and the Child Care Board (CCB) Royals.

The match climaxed activities which began earlier in the afternoon with the Nation’s Bajan Tuh De Bone Funathlon 5K run/walk.

It brought the Lions’ 2016 season to a successful climax, as they extended their unbeaten run in fun matches to five. (WH)
